设为首页 收藏本站
查看: 1562|回复: 0

[经验分享] 文件服务器迁移之三(Robocopy进行大量迁移)

[复制链接]
累计签到:1 天
连续签到:1 天
发表于 2016-9-23 08:56:09 | 显示全部楼层 |阅读模式
因为FSMT已经停止使用,而FSRM 的迁移速度并不十分理想,而且微软官方也有说明:Windows Server 迁移工具 (WSMT) 的文件迁移 (FSRM) 部分面向小型数据集(小于 100 GB 的数据)。 它会通过 HTTPS 逐个复制文件。 对于大型数据集,我们建议使用 Windows Server 2012 R2 或 Windows Server 2012 随附的 Robocopy.exe 版本。
即然官方建议我们用2012或2012R2所带的Robocopy,所以选它来做这次迁移的工具!
我现在需要的将一台2008R2服务器上,近2T的数据迁移到一台全新的2012R2机器上,依之前的测试,在1G 的网络环境中,平均迁移速度可以达到每分钟3G 左右,最高可以到达4G,所以,估计完成这次迁移大约需要8-12小时,刚才可以利用周末晚上完迁移!
确定好时间,通知用户后,开始进行!
首先,为确保迁移过程中,不会有文件更新、写入,需将2008R2旧文件服务器上需要迁移的共享目录中的共享权限设置为只读!
wKioL1fj2-eykAEoAADZAOBVm8c741.jpg
切换到2012R2新文件服务器,进到命令提示下,可以用Robocopy /? 查看详细参数,有兴趣的可以每个参数去仔细研究!如下图:
wKioL1fj2-jSbQvcAADHtJxy3Pw434.jpg
常用参数:
源 :: 源目录(驱动器:\路径或\\服务器\共享\路径)。
目标 :: 目标目录(驱动器:\路径或\\服务器\共享\路径)。
/S :: 复制子目录,但不复制空的子目录。
/E :: 复制子目录,包括空的子目录。
/COPY:复制标记:: 要复制的文件内容(默认为 /COPY:DAT)。
(复制标记: D=数据,A=属性,T=时间戳)。
(S=安全=NTFS ACL,O=所有者信息,U=审核信息)。
/SEC :: 复制具有安全性的文件(等同于 /COPY:DATS)
/COPYALL :: 复制所有文件信息(等同于 /COPY:DATSOU)
/MT[:n] :: 使用 n 个线程进行多线程复制(默认值为 8)
n 必须至少为 1,但不得大于 128。
该选项与 /IPG 和 /EFSRAW 选项不兼容。
使用 /LOG 选项重定向输出以便获得最佳性能。
/R:n :: 失败副本的重试次数: 默认为 1 百万。
在本次迁移中,因为完全需要文件服务器,包换所有文件、目录、权限等,所以使用如下参考:
robocopy \\2008R2\e$\Share e:\Share /e /copyall /mt:20 /R:3 /log:E:\log\Share.log
\\2008R2\e$\Share 源目录,即旧2008R2服务器上的目录,也可以直接使用共享,
e:\Share目标目录,即新的2012R2服务器上的目录。
/E 复制子目录,包括空的子目录。
/COPYALL 复制所有文件信息(包括数据、属性、时间戳、安全、所有者、审核信息等)
/MT:20 使用 20 个线程进行多线程复制
/R:3 失败副本的重试3次数,由于 默认为 1 百万,如果碰到无法复制的文件,复试1百万次的话,估计得几天时间,所以建议修改
/log:E:\log\Share.log将复制结果记录到日志文件,以便查看错误或是失败的信息
以上命令后,就是慢长的等待了!
结束后,打开LOG文件,可以看到所有复制的文件目录、大小等信息:
wKiom1fj2-mAItR-AABS5AUx1OA686.jpg
最后会有汇总,总共文件、目录数量、大小、时间等信息!
wKiom1fj2-rR_rzlAABRCqEziiQ133.jpg
从汇总信息来看,此目录总共942G,开始时间1:17:52,结束时间:4:20:29共用时:2:43:49,平均速度约3G/分钟!
用以上方法,完成另个几个共享目录的复制,然后再停用旧服务器上的共享、启用新服务器上的共享,总共2TB,总共用时约8小时!
相比之前的两个工具:FSMT和FSRM,效率确实高了不少!


运维网声明 1、欢迎大家加入本站运维交流群:群②:261659950 群⑤:202807635 群⑦870801961 群⑧679858003
2、本站所有主题由该帖子作者发表,该帖子作者与运维网享有帖子相关版权
3、所有作品的著作权均归原作者享有,请您和我们一样尊重他人的著作权等合法权益。如果您对作品感到满意,请购买正版
4、禁止制作、复制、发布和传播具有反动、淫秽、色情、暴力、凶杀等内容的信息,一经发现立即删除。若您因此触犯法律,一切后果自负,我们对此不承担任何责任
5、所有资源均系网友上传或者通过网络收集,我们仅提供一个展示、介绍、观摩学习的平台,我们不对其内容的准确性、可靠性、正当性、安全性、合法性等负责,亦不承担任何法律责任
6、所有作品仅供您个人学习、研究或欣赏,不得用于商业或者其他用途,否则,一切后果均由您自己承担,我们对此不承担任何法律责任
7、如涉及侵犯版权等问题,请您及时通知我们,我们将立即采取措施予以解决
8、联系人Email:admin@iyunv.com 网址:www.yunweiku.com

所有资源均系网友上传或者通过网络收集,我们仅提供一个展示、介绍、观摩学习的平台,我们不对其承担任何法律责任,如涉及侵犯版权等问题,请您及时通知我们,我们将立即处理,联系人Email:kefu@iyunv.com,QQ:1061981298 本贴地址:https://www.yunweiku.com/thread-276190-1-1.html 上篇帖子: VNC连接Linux 下篇帖子: SMB文件共享——实验篇
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

扫码加入运维网微信交流群X

扫码加入运维网微信交流群

扫描二维码加入运维网微信交流群,最新一手资源尽在官方微信交流群!快快加入我们吧...

扫描微信二维码查看详情

客服E-mail:kefu@iyunv.com 客服QQ:1061981298


QQ群⑦:运维网交流群⑦ QQ群⑧:运维网交流群⑧ k8s群:运维网kubernetes交流群


提醒:禁止发布任何违反国家法律、法规的言论与图片等内容;本站内容均来自个人观点与网络等信息,非本站认同之观点.


本站大部分资源是网友从网上搜集分享而来,其版权均归原作者及其网站所有,我们尊重他人的合法权益,如有内容侵犯您的合法权益,请及时与我们联系进行核实删除!



合作伙伴: 青云cloud

快速回复 返回顶部 返回列表